NEWS YOU MISSED YESTERDAY:

- FINDING NEVERLAND's Laura Michelle Kelly, MOTOWN and more will appear at BROADWAY IN BRYANT PARK this week!
- We got a first look (right) at Betty Buckley and Rachel York in GREY GARDENS in L.A., plus preview footage of MOTOWN's return to NYC, and a sneak peek at Charles Busch in costume for THE DIVINE SISTER at Bucks County Playhouse!
- Darren Criss, Michael Urie and Ramin Karimloo are set for WHITE RABBIT RED RABBIT this August.
- And Broadway will dim its lights this week in memory of John McMartin...
